USER MANUAL KC24 CDA

Taking Care of your Sink

During installation, protect the sink from scratches, scuffs and other damage.

Do not overtighten or strain plumbing fittings.

The moulding and edges of the sink must be absolutely level so water flows off the drainer.

Your CDA ceramic sink features the natural characteristics of fireclay ceramics. The dimensions may very from the specification due to the manufacturing process, as each sink is made by hand.

Due to the nature of the manufacturing process and the materials from which it is made, small blemishes will be evident on the surface of the ceramic finish. These blemishes are under the glaze; they are inherent properties and are in no way detrimental to the performance of the sink – they are consistent with the traditional appeal of hand-made fireclay sinks.

Your CDA sink is manufactured using material developed specifically to withstand the rigours of everyday kitchen use. However, we advise you to follow these precautions to keep the sink in pristine condition:

  • Avoid dropping heavy, sharp or metallic objects into the sink as they may scratch or damage the surface.
  • Do not use abrasive liquids, powders or steel pads to clean the sink as they will damage the sink surface and make it more susceptible to staining. The sink may be cleaned with a dilute bleach solution.
  • Do not use a plastic washing-up bowl in the sink as grit and other particles may become embedded in the bowl and scratch or erode the sink surface.
  • The surface of the sink can be affected by certain chemicals e.g. neat bleach, nail polish remover, paint stripper, solvents, brush cleaner and insecticides. If any of these substances come into contact with the sink, wipe off immediately with a dry cloth, wash with mild detergent and rinse with water.
  • Do not use neat bleach or other harsh cleaning agents on the metal sink waste as this may cause tarnishing. This is especially important if the waste is of the brass/brass finish type.
  • Do not place very hot objects directly on the sink, place them on a special surface (board) made from wood or plastic, etc.
    • Particularly stubborn organic stains can be removed effectively by soaking the sink in a biological washing-powder solution, dishwasher powder solution or a dilute bleach solution.
    • If the sink comes into contact with acidic materials, rinse immediately with plenty of water and wipe with a soft dry cloth.
  • Do not leave rusty objects in contact with the sink. Rust can cause staining, cracking or even permanent damage to the sink surface.
  • To avoid staining of the surface do not leave food or other materials with corrosive properties such as juices, salt, vinegar, mustard etc. on the sink for a long time.
    • After using the sink, rinse it clean with warm soapy water and rinse with clean water before wiping dry.

This Guarantee is Valid Providing that

• The product has been installed by a suitably qualified person.
• Installation has been carried out in accordance with instructions and current legislation.
• Proof of purchase can be produced.
• The product has been used for domestic purposes only.
• The product has not been tampered with or repair attempted or modified by any unauthorised person.
• All products have been installed in accordance local water by laws and any building regulations in force

This Guarantee does not Cover

• Damage by misuse, neglect or transit.
• Use of parts not used or recommended by CDA.
• Routine maintenance, general wear ∅ tear and installation faults.
• Products used for commercial or professional purposes.

Your sink is guaranteed against defects in materials and/or workmanship for 5 years. At the discretion of CDA, should a fault arise the sink may be repaired or replaced and agreed refitting may be reimbursed on receipt on a faulty sink/part, once they have been inspected and deemed faulty.

GUARANTEE 5 YEAR
